Package: prayer
Version: 1.2.2.1-2
Severity: serious
Justification: The packet is not usable

/etc/init.d/prayer start dies with "Starting webmail server: 
prayerprayer PANICLOG:
  Failed to open panic log file: "paniclog"
  Error was: Aug 06 18:02:21 [3157] config: lock_dir not defined
 failed!" 

Workaround:
add the following lines tot /etc/prayer/prayer.cf:
help_dir = "/tmp"
#lock_dir = "/tmp"
